Output 6a617ecdd53e50d6e8706aa797800834d91b8eaff8b8a4c182cee0e4400d7c3e:1

value
1325227
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7c1040f94828729e31394c87521de6ecda1462d OP_EQUAL
address
3MMpRmJBx6PeKGsLtktYHmxkjjqDBaXuDm
transaction
6a617ecdd53e50d6e8706aa797800834d91b8eaff8b8a4c182cee0e4400d7c3e
confirmations
38451
spent
true